Austin’s drinking scene has never been better, with numerous bars offering absolutely great boozy beverages, from cocktails to beer to wine. With that in mind, Eater is highlighting the city’s best all-around bars, those establishments that serve stellar mixed drinks, as well as excellent beer and/or wine selections, so there’s something for every taste.
Austin’s most versatile bars include King Bee with its varied choices, wine bar and more Vino Vino, campus hang Hole in the Wall, among others. This update adds Nickel City to the mix.
